Getting sedimental about our oceans

Getting sedimental about our oceans

Commonwealth Scientific and Industrial Research Organisation (CSIRO) Oceans and Atmosphere

Published: 29 September 2022

Seafloor sediments record past oceans, climates, ecosystems and even natural disasters. Using cores and DNA analysis, scientists uncover histories of algal blooms, ice sheet shifts, volcanic eruptions and carbon capture beneath the waves.
